Web Development
Websites and web platforms that load fast, rank well, and don't fall over when you ship on a Friday. Every one bespoke, none of it dragged out of a template.
Web Development
Bespoke websites
Marketing sites, campaign microsites and brochure sites built from scratch to your brand. Every section is yours, designed and coded for the job, not assembled from a theme.
Web applications
Dashboards, portals and internal tools with real authentication, roles and data behind them. The kind of app your team lives in all day, and actually likes.
SaaS platforms
Multi-tenant products with billing, onboarding, admin and the lot. We build the whole thing from the ground up, or slot cleanly into an existing codebase.
Headless & custom commerce
Online shops on Shopify Hydrogen or a fully custom stack: bespoke checkout, subscriptions, memberships and a storefront that stays fast as the catalogue grows.
Content & CMS
A headless CMS your editors enjoy using, with live preview, structured content and translations for every market you sell in.
APIs & integrations
REST and GraphQL APIs, plus the plumbing to payments, auth, CRMs, analytics and whatever else your business already runs on.
Performance & SEO
Server-rendered by default, Core Web Vitals in the green, structured data and the technical SEO groundwork that helps you actually rank.
Accessibility
WCAG 2.2 AA as standard, tested with real assistive tech, so the site works for everyone and keeps you the right side of the law.
- 01Marketing & brand sites
- 02Web applications & dashboards
- 03SaaS platforms
- 04Headless & custom commerce
- 05Custom CMS & editor UX
- 06Design systems in code
- 07REST & GraphQL APIs
- 08Auth, roles & user accounts
- 09Payments & subscriptions
- 10Third-party integrations
- 11Internationalisation (i18n)
- 12Progressive web apps
- 13Core Web Vitals & performance
- 14Technical SEO & structured data
- 15Accessibility (WCAG 2.2 AA)
- 16Analytics & A/B testing
Server-first
We render on the server by default. You get a fast first paint, real SEO, and a site that still behaves on a slow connection.
Typed end to end
TypeScript from the database to the button. Fewer surprises in production, and faster changes later.
Built to hand over
Documented, tested and componentised, so your team keeps shipping long after we've gone.
- Next.js
- React
- TypeScript
- Node
- GraphQL
- tRPC
- Headless CMS
- PostgreSQL
- Stripe
- Edge
- Playwright